kart
🏎️ MARIO KART JS EDITION
L'expérience de course culte, directement dans votre navigateur !
Mario Kart JS est un hommage technique et ludique au célèbre jeu de course de Nintendo, entièrement développé avec Three.js. Glissez, boostez et utilisez des objets iconiques sur un circuit en 3D fluide et coloré.
🌟 Caractéristiques principales
- Moteur de Drift Avancé : Maîtrisez le dérapage pour charger votre barre de turbo. Relâchez au bon moment pour déclencher un Mini-Turbo ou un Ultra Mini-Turbo !
- Système d'Objets complet :
- 🍄 Champignon : Un boost de vitesse instantané pour rattraper vos concurrents.
- 🐢 Carapace : Tirez droit devant vous pour étourdir les adversaires.
- 🍌 Banane : Laissez un piège derrière vous pour provoquer une glissade.
- IA Compétitive : Affrontez 5 pilotes (Luigi, Peach, Yoshi, Toad et Bowser) dotés d'un comportement de conduite dynamique.
- Circuit Détaillé : Un tracé complet avec des vibreurs, des décors (arbres, tuyaux, tribunes) et une gestion des limites de piste (hors-piste ralentissant).
- Interface Immersive (HUD) : Classement en temps réel, compteur de vitesse, gestion des tours et une minimap fonctionnelle pour surveiller la position de vos rivaux.
🎮 Commandes
- Z / Q / S / D ou Flèches : Conduire et tourner.
- SHIFT (Maintenu) : Déraper (Drift).
- ESPACE : Utiliser l'objet.
- MENU : Pause et réglages.
🛠️ Détails techniques
Ce projet est une démonstration de ce qu'il est possible de réaliser avec le WebGL moderne :
- Three.js : Rendu 3D, gestion des lumières (Shadow Maps) et du brouillard.
- CatmullRomCurve3 : Utilisation de courbes mathématiques pour générer une géométrie de piste complexe et gérer le guidage des PNJs.
- Physique Custom : Gestion de l'accélération, de la friction et des collisions sans moteur physique externe pour une performance optimale.
| Published | 23 days ago |
| Status | Released |
| Platforms | HTML5 |
| Author | Thibaut1002 |

Leave a comment
Log in with itch.io to leave a comment.